Taggen von Ressourcen im AWS Database Migration Service - AWS Database Migration Service

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

Taggen von Ressourcen im AWS Database Migration Service

Sie können Tags im AWS Database Migration Service (AWS DMS) verwenden, um Ihren Ressourcen Metadaten hinzuzufügen. Darüber hinaus können Sie diese Tags zusammen mit AWS Identity and Access Management (IAM-) Richtlinien verwenden, um den Zugriff auf AWS DMS-Ressourcen zu verwalten und zu steuern, welche Aktionen auf die AWS DMS-Ressourcen angewendet werden können. Außerdem können Sie mit diesen Tags auch Kosten verfolgen, indem Ausgaben für ähnlich getaggte Ressourcen gruppiert werden.

Alle AWS DMS-Ressourcen können mit folgenden Tags versehen werden:

  • Zertifikate

  • Datenanbieter

  • Datenmigrationen

  • Endpunkte

  • Ereignisabonnements

  • Instance-Profile

  • Migrationsprojekte

  • Replikations-Instances

  • Replikations-Subnetzgruppen

  • Replikationsaufgaben

Ein AWS DMS-Tag ist ein Name-Wert-Paar, das Sie definieren und einer DMS-Ressource zuordnen. AWS Der Name wird als Schlüssel bezeichnet. Die Angabe eines Wertes für den Schlüssel ist optional. Sie können Tags verwenden, um einer DMS-Ressource beliebige Informationen zuzuweisen. AWS Ein Tag-Schlüssel könnte z. B. verwendet werden, um eine Kategorie zu definieren, und ein Tag-Wert könnte ein Element in dieser Kategorie sein. Sie könnten beispielsweise den Tag-Schlüssel „Projekt“ und den Tagwert „Salix“ definieren, der angibt, dass die AWS DMS-Ressource dem Salix-Projekt zugewiesen ist. Sie könnten auch Tags verwenden, um AWS DMS-Ressourcen so zu kennzeichnen, dass sie für Test- oder Produktionszwecke verwendet werden, indem Sie einen Schlüssel wie environment=test oder environment =production verwenden. Wir empfehlen, einen konsistenten Satz von Tag-Schlüsseln zu verwenden, um die Nachverfolgung von Metadaten im Zusammenhang mit DMS-Ressourcen zu vereinfachen. AWS

Verwenden Sie Tags, um Ihre AWS Rechnung so zu organisieren, dass sie Ihrer eigenen Kostenstruktur entspricht. Melden Sie sich dazu an, um Ihre AWS-Konto Rechnung mit den Tag-Schlüsselwerten zu erhalten. Um dann die Kosten kombinierter Ressourcen anzuzeigen, organisieren Sie Ihre Fakturierungsinformationen nach Ressourcen mit gleichen Tag-Schlüsselwerten. Beispielsweise können Sie mehrere Ressourcen mit einem bestimmten Anwendungsnamen markieren und dann Ihre Fakturierungsinformationen so organisieren, dass Sie die Gesamtkosten dieser Anwendung über mehrere Services hinweg sehen können. Weitere Informationen finden Sie unter Verwendung von Kostenzuordnungs-Tags im AWS Billing -Benutzerhandbuch.

Jede AWS DMS-Ressource hat ein Tag-Set, das alle Tags enthält, die dieser AWS DMS-Ressource zugewiesen sind. Ein Tag-Satz kann bis zu zehn Tags enthalten oder leer sein. Wenn Sie einer AWS DMS-Ressource ein Tag hinzufügen, das denselben Schlüssel wie ein vorhandenes Tag auf der Ressource hat, überschreibt der neue Wert den alten Wert.

AWS weist Ihren Tags keine semantische Bedeutung zu; Tags werden ausschließlich als Zeichenketten interpretiert. AWS Abhängig von den Einstellungen, die Sie bei der Erstellung der Ressource verwenden, kann AWS DMS Tags für eine DMS-Ressource festlegen.

In der folgenden Liste werden die Eigenschaften eines AWS DMS-Tags beschrieben.

  • Der Tag-Schlüssel ist der erforderliche Name des Tags. Der Zeichenfolgenwert kann aus 1 bis 128 Unicode-Zeichen bestehen. Ihm darf kein "aws:" oder "dms:" vorangestellt werden. Die Zeichenfolge darf nur Unicode-Zeichen, Ziffern, Leerzeichen sowie '_', '.', '/', '=', '+', '-' enthalten (Java-Regex: "^([\\p{L}\\p{Z}\\p{N}_.:/=+\\-]*)$").

  • Der Tag-Wert ist ein optionaler Zeichenfolgenwert des Tags. Der Zeichenfolgenwert kann aus 1 bis 256 Unicode-Zeichen bestehen. Ihm darf kein "aws:" oder "dms:" vorangestellt werden. Die Zeichenfolge darf nur Unicode-Zeichen, Ziffern, Leerzeichen sowie '_', '.', '/', '=', '+', '-' enthalten (Java-Regex: "^([\\p{L}\\p{Z}\\p{N}_.:/=+\\-]*)$").

    Die Werte innerhalb eines Tag-Satzes müssen nicht eindeutig und können null sein. Sie können beispielsweise ein Schlüssel-Wert-Paar in einem Tag-Set von haben. project/Trinity and cost-center/Trinity

Sie können die AWS CLI oder die AWS DMS-API verwenden, um Tags zu DMS-Ressourcen hinzuzufügen, aufzulisten und zu AWS löschen. Wenn Sie die AWS CLI oder die AWS DMS-API verwenden, müssen Sie den Amazon-Ressourcennamen (ARN) für die AWS DMS-Ressource angeben, mit der Sie arbeiten möchten. Weitere Informationen zum Konstruieren eines ARN finden Sie unter Erstellung eines Amazon-Ressourcennamens (ARN) für AWS DMS.

Beachten Sie, dass Tags für Autorisierungszwecke zwischengespeichert werden. Aus diesem Grund kann es bei Hinzufügungen und Aktualisierungen von Tags auf AWS DMS-Ressourcen mehrere Minuten dauern, bis sie verfügbar sind.

API

Mithilfe der DMS-API können Sie Tags für eine AWS DMS-Ressource hinzufügen, auflisten oder entfernen. AWS

  • Verwenden Sie die Operation, um einer AWS DMS-Ressource ein Tag hinzuzufügen. AddTagsToResource

  • Verwenden Sie die Operation, um Tags aufzulisten, die einer AWS DMS-Ressource zugewiesen sind. ListTagsForResource

  • Verwenden Sie die Operation, um Tags aus einer AWS DMS-Ressource zu entfernen. RemoveTagsFromResource

Weitere Informationen zum Konstruieren des erforderlichen ARN finden Sie unter Erstellung eines Amazon-Ressourcennamens (ARN) für AWS DMS.

Bei der Arbeit mit XML mithilfe der AWS DMS-API verwenden Tags das folgende Schema:

<Tagging> <TagSet> <Tag> <Key>Project</Key> <Value>Trinity</Value> </Tag> <Tag> <Key>User</Key> <Value>Jones</Value> </Tag> </TagSet> </Tagging>

Die folgende Tabelle enthält eine Liste der zulässigen XML-Tags und deren Eigenschaften. Beachten Sie, dass für die Werte für Schlüssel und Wert zwischen Klein- und Großbuchstaben unterschieden wird. Zum Beispiel sind "project = Trinity" und "PROJECT = Trinity" zwei verschiedene Tags.

Markieren von Elementen Beschreibung
TagSet Ein Tag-Satz ist ein Container für alle Tags, die einer Amazon Amazon RDS-Ressource zugewiesen sind. Es ist nur ein Tag-Satz pro Ressource zulässig. Sie arbeiten mit a TagSet nur über die AWS DMS-API.
Tag Ein Tag ist ein benutzerdefiniertes Schlüssel-Wert-Paar. Ein Tag-Satz kann 1 bis 10 Tags enthalten.
Schlüssel

Ein Schlüssel ist der erforderliche Name des Tags. Der Zeichenfolgenwert kann aus 1 bis 128 Unicode-Zeichen bestehen. Ihm darf kein "aws:" oder "dms:" vorangestellt werden. Die Zeichenfolge darf nur Unicode-Zeichen, Ziffern, Leerzeichen sowie '_', '.', '/', '=', '+', '-' enthalten (Java-Regex: "^([\\p{L}\\p{Z}\\p{N}_.:/=+\\-]*)$").

Schlüssel müssen in einem Tag-Satz eindeutig sein. Sie können beispielsweise kein Schlüsselpaar in einem Tag-Set mit demselben Schlüssel, aber mit unterschiedlichen Werten haben, wie z. project/Trinity and project/Xanadu

Wert

Ein Wert ist der optionale Wert des Tags. Der Zeichenfolgenwert kann aus 1 bis 256 Unicode-Zeichen bestehen. Ihm darf kein "aws:" oder "dms:" vorangestellt werden. Die Zeichenfolge darf nur Unicode-Zeichen, Ziffern, Leerzeichen sowie '_', '.', '/', '=', '+', '-' enthalten (Java-Regex: "^([\\p{L}\\p{Z}\\p{N}_.:/=+\\-]*)$").

Die Werte innerhalb eines Tag-Satzes müssen nicht eindeutig und können null sein. Sie können beispielsweise ein Schlüssel-Wert-Paar in einem Tag-Set von haben. project/Trinity and cost-center/Trinity